- Ignition - On / Vehicle - In Service Mode & Engine - Off
- Verify DTC P0502, P0503, P0721, P0722, P0723, P077C, P077D, P2160, or P2161 is not set as current or in history
- If any of the DTCs are set Refer to:Diagnostic Trouble Code (DTC) List - Vehicle
- If none of the DTCs are set
- Ignition On - Engine Running - Greater than 1 min
- Ignition OFF for greater than 2 min, key out of the ignition/keyless start transmitter 1 m (3 ft) away from the vehicle, and all vehicle systems OFF.
- Ignition - On / Vehicle - In Service Mode & Engine - Off
- Verify DTC P17D4, P185F, P279A, P279B, P279C is only set as a history DTC.
- If any of the DTCs are set as current. Refer to: Circuit/System Testing
- If any of the DTCs are only set as history. Refer to Diagnostic Aids before proceeding with Circuit/System Testing.
- If none of the DTCs are set
- Clear All Vehicle DTCs
- Operate the vehicle within the Conditions for Running the DTC. You may also operate the vehicle within the conditions that you observed from the Freeze Frame/Failure Records data.
- When operating the vehicle within the Conditions for Running the DTC, monitor the following parameters (they should match each other and show a smooth/steady curve when viewed in graph form):
- Transmission OSS scan too parameter in the Transmission Control Module scan tool data list
- Transfer Case OSS scan too parameter in the Engine Control Module scan tool data list
- If the above parameters do not match or are not smooth
Refer to: Diagnostic Trouble Code (DTC) List - Vehicle A fault exists with the B14S?Transmission Output Shaft Speed Sensor or the B115 Vehicle Speed Sensor.
- If the above parameters match and are smooth
- All OK.
